The scope of legal protection for listed buildings

This List entry helps identify the building designated at this address for its special architectural or historic interest.

Unless the List entry states otherwise, it includes both the structure itself and any object or structure fixed to it (whether inside or outside) as well as any object or structure within the curtilage of the building.

For these purposes, to be included within the curtilage of the building, the object or structure must have formed part of the land since before 1st July 1948.

Details

BURFORD AND UPTON WITNEY STREET AND SIGNET (North side) SP2512 (Enlargement) The Mill Coach House 7/243 and attached mounting block.

GV II Former mill stables now converted to house. Probably mid-cl9. Coursed and squared rubble with Cotswold stone roof. U-plan with pent link and further wing to right. 2 projecting gables with coped verges and finials the left-hand one with oculus, loft door with segmental head window below, the right-hand one with 2 part-blocked arches and a loft door over; mounting block by left-hand arch. Pent roofed lobby between gables with stable door in left-hand part and under-built lobby to right-hand part. Double doors to extension to right. A sensitive conversion even incorporating the horse boxes.
